Nippy norman pipes fitted to my F650GS, its a Remus system minus the CAT in polished stainless (smoother than a brazillian:augie), matched to my akrapovic end can, i find the sound is deeper throatier through the gears, there apears to be improved acceleration the bike feels livelier.:thumb
It looks nicer polished and blingy i think the actual pipes are continual sized through out and slightly bigger bored, the old one reduced at the cat. here are some comparison pics:

I've got a BMW marked Akro Ti/carbon can, but wasn't happy with the muted humm with the baffles in or the...slightly too loud....bark with them out.

In the end, I took the baffle out and tuned it by gradually drilling out a pattern of holes until I got the sound and noise level I has happy with.
